What's in the News Mexico is considering legal action against Adidas after the company collaborated with a Mexican American designer to launch a product inspired by traditional Indigenous sandals, citing concerns about big companies using Indigenous designs without proper compensation (Reuters).

Rémunération vs marché: La rémunération totale de Bjorn ($USD 8.51M ) est supérieure à la moyenne des entreprises de taille similaire sur le marché German ($USD 5.53M ).

Rémunération et revenus: La rémunération de Bjorn a été cohérente avec les performances de l'entreprise au cours de l'année écoulée.
